Q: Is 257,380 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 257,380 is not a prime number.

Why is 257,380 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 257380 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 10 17 20 34 68 85 170 340 757 1,514 3,028 3,785 7,570 12,869 15,140 25,738 51,476 64,345 128,690 and 257,380, with no remainder.

Since 257,380 cannot be divided by just 1 and 257,380, it is not a prime number.
